New Orleans youngster finishes T2 at DC&P 10-year-old Morgan Guepet of New Orleans finished tied for 2nd place in her age division in the 2016 Drive, Chip, and Putt Championship at Augusta National prior to the start of The Masters. She is one of 80 junior golfers nationwide who competed, and she is the only one from Louisiana. Morgan advanced through local, sub-regional and regional qualifiers. She earned her trip to Augusta by winning the regional Drive, Chip, and Putt last year at the Golf Club of Houston, host club of the Shell Houston Open. Golfers are scored on a series of drives, chips, and putts. The drive and chip skills were conducted Sunday on Augusta’s practice facility.
